Subject: Handover — SQL lint rules

Hi Priya,

Handing over the sqlcheck rollout for the Ledgerbird repo. The new lint rules block unqualified SELECT * and missing transaction wrappers; CI enforces them as of Monday. Note: three legacy migration files carry explicit suppressions — do not remove them, the fix is scheduled next sprint. If the linter false-positives during your shift, suppress with a ticket reference and notify the data platform team at the address below.

escalation mailbox, bafog-fafog: ulador@paliqlabs.internal

## Deploying the Gatewick Proctor Queue

Deploys are pretty painless: push to main, wait for the pipeline, then watch the queue drain dashboard for five minutes. If candidates pile up mid-exam, roll back first and ask questions later — the queue replays safely. Everything the workers care about lives in one config block, shown here for reference.

settings of bafof-yagef:
JOROX_PIN=8740
JOROX_TENANT=pelox
JOROX_METRICS_HOST=metrics.jorox.qorvelworks.internal
JOROX_SEAL=seal_c78f63c1
JOROX_STANDBY_TEAM=norax

## Ownership

The thumbnail generation queue (aka "Snapjar") lives in the media-workers repo. It's mostly hands-off, but if jobs pile up past 10k, someone needs to poke the resize pods. New folks: don't tweak the retry settings without asking first. Questions, pages, and blame all go to the owner listed below.

account owner for bawip-tahag: Raleth Quenok

Break-Glass Access — Charsniff Encoding Service

Scope: emergency admin on the upload encoding-detection tier (Morrow cluster).

Use only when detection workers reject all uploads or the BOM-stripping stage wedges. Steps: page secondary on-call, freeze deploys, open the break-glass session from the bastion, and capture an audit note before touching config. Sessions auto-expire in 30 minutes. Revert config drift after the incident. To open the break-glass session, enter the recovery passphrase below.

vault phrase of yagag-tajep = rusvan-rusael-kelox-fenys-ulaael-kasix-praael-holok-framir